Prince William flies economy class on his 34th birthday

The Prince was returning home from a disappointing football match between England and Slovakia in France.
Prince William

The future King of England turned 34 on Tuesday, but instead of being pampered and treated like royalty on his birthday, Prince William was forced to stow his own bags as he caught an economy class flight home from France.

Surprising passengers on the flight from Lyon to Heathrow, the president of the Football Association appeared downcast as he boarded the plane.

According to the Daily Mail, the Prince dozed off as soon as he sat down, clearly tuckered out from the Euro 2016 match between England and Slovakia.

The people’s Prince! Wills previously flown economy class from New York to Washington DC in 2014.

James, a fellow football fan and passenger on the same plane, told the publication, “We were all tired after being put through a roller coaster of emotions so I don’t blame him for falling asleep.”

The Prince flew to the Saint-Exupery airport in Lyon to arrive just in time for the match, where he cheered excitedly alongside chairman Greg Dyke in a dark blue suit adorned with a striped blue, red and white tie.

Before kick-off, the second in line to the British throne joined in on a resounding chorus of the English National Anthem, God Save the Queen.

Although he may have had a lonely flight back home, the father-of-two would have been delighted to meet up with his wife Duchess Catherine and their children, George, two, and Charlotte, one, for birthday celebrations.

Meanwhile, this isn’t the first time the Prince has snubbed first class to fly economy. In 2014, he sat among passengers in coach as he flew from New York to Washington DC to meet President Barack Obama.
